Gong cha, the bubble tea brand, opened its first location in the vibrant city of Miami on June 1st! Located at 10720 W. Flagler St., Unit #7, this new location marks a significant milestone as they bring the rich, authentic taste of Taiwanese bubble tea to the heart of South Florida.

Miami, known for its diverse culture and dynamic culinary scene, is a great backdrop for Gong cha’s innovative and refreshing drinks. The new location offers a full menu of favorites, including Gong cha’s signature Milk Foam, fruity teas, and customizable bubble tea options. Each drink is crafted with the finest ingredients, ensuring an unparalleled taste experience that has captivated tea lovers around the globe.

Founded in Taiwan in 2006, Gong cha is a premier bubble tea brand. Its commitment to quality starts with its name: “Gong cha” means to offer the best tea to the emperor from all of one’s possessions. Gong cha offers its customers the ability to customize their beverage to their exact specifications. With more than 2,200 locations across 23 countries, it is also one of the fastest-growing bubble tea brands, attracting entrepreneurs across the globe to its lucrative franchise program.
